History, Archaeology & Significance

Kourion is an ancient city-kingdom on the southwestern coast of Cyprus, inhabited from the Neolithic period through the early Byzantine era. Its spectacular cliff-top Greco-Roman theatre, the Sanctuary of Apollo Hylates, elaborate floor mosaics, and early Christian basilica reflect successive layers of civilization spanning over 3,000 years. The city was devastated by an earthquake in 365 CE, preserving a remarkable archaeological snapshot of late Roman daily life.
